1.      Avoid Patent Battle to Replace Marketing Competition
It’s clear that patent battle fires up after Android started to boom. Each Android phone needs to pay $5 to Microsoft for license fee, which largely increase the cost of Android phone and make it hard to remain competitive. Then HTC, Samsung as well as Motorola weresued for patent infringement by Apple one by one all over the world, which makes Samsung’s newest Galaxy Tab 1.0 delay to launch in Europe or may be banned in Europe. That’s very frustrating for Google. All this happened is because Google doesn’t have any Patent to fight back. If Google acquires Motorola successfully, the 17000 patents and 7500 more Patents applicants will help Android manufactures get out of this situation.

Malware Threats on Android-Based Phones

Google not only has to face the lawsuit brought by his competitors, but also is trapped as Android system is reported with more possibilities to get malware threats by cybercriminals. Android-base phone is 2.5 times likely to be attacked by malwares than it 6 months ago. Lookout, which offers mobile security service, deduced it from its data collected from more than 700 thousand apps and 10 million devices worldwide.

Why Android?

Android has an open operating system, its permission system encourages developers to invent wide range of different functions apps. Some may be able to access to users private account info and so on. It sorts of depend on user’s judgement to install it or not. Moreover, Android apps are available not only in Android market, but also android app store at Amazon as well as carrier’s, which makes malware easily access to users. Google Trapped in Patent lawsuit by Apple Microsoft Oracle

Google vs Microsoft
 Last year Oracle sued Google for the Android mobile operating technology infringe upon Oracle’s java patents. Then Apple began to put  HTC,Samsung, Motorola and such Android-based OEM on the court for patents infringement. To be worse, it’s not the end, it’s just the beginning.
Then, Google even lost the Nortel bidding for defensive use. Nortel’s 6000+ patents come into possession of Microsoft, Apple, RIM and Oracle. This is too bad for Google as google is nowhere compared with Apple’s 10000+ patents and Mecrosoft’s 20000+.

Samsung Galaxy S II sells crazily, Will Samsung Threaten Apple.inc in the Smartphone Market?

Samsung Galaxy S II is popular in EU right now

Samsung Galaxy S II launched in its home base of South Korea on April 29 before it available at Japan and European countries in May and was reported to sell 5 million in 85 days with a big bang. It kind of deserves it as this popular phone sports a dual-core 1.2MHZ processor along with a 8-mega pixel camera in back, and a 2-mega pixel camera in front. And it is the first device running on the Android 2.3 Gingerbread OS. It draws a lot of attention and becomes more popular in some markets compared with iPhone 4. In some carriers, this high-end smartphone is treated as the flagship phone recently. And the current news show an all-white version will be released in Europe on Augest 15th, which is thought to be more elegant and may bring another high purchasing wave of the Samsung Galaxy S II. It was also said this phone will be available in the USA in Fall or September with the three major carriers.
